JOB TITLE: Research Scientist CLASSIFICATION: Exempt

DEPARTMENT: Research & Development DATE REVISED: 9-16-2026

SUMMARY

Assist in the coordination and execution of departmental projects (assigned and/or team projects). Provide technical support in the development of vaccines; including but not limited to antigen discovery, formulation, process development, assay development, and efficacy studies. Will also interact with Department Heads, research team members, and other departments, for the purpose of determining needs, reporting results, providing technical support and for product development and improvement.

EDUCATION/EXPERIENCE

  • The position requires an M.S. or Ph.D. degree in Microbiology or related life sciences field. Candidates with 2-4 years of experience are preferred with Molecular Biology, in-vitro Assay Development, Cell Culture, Recombinant DNA techniques, Virology and Vaccinology expertise.
  • The candidate must be familiar with the principle of veterinary biologics, research and development of biologics, diagnostic assays, vaccine production, quality control and regulatory agencies.
  • The position requires good verbal and written skills, knowledge of the use and care of animals, and good manufacturing, laboratory, and clinical practices.
